Unigine::Cigi::ICigiHatHotRequest Class
Header: | #include <CigiClientInterface.h> |
Inherits: | ICigiHostPacket |
This class represents the CIGI HAT/HOT Request packet interface.
CIGI plugin must be loaded.
ICigiHatHotRequest Class
Members
int getHatHotID()
Returns the value of the HAT/HOT ID parameter specified in the packet.Return value
HAT/HOT ID parameter value.int getEntityID()
Returns the entity ID specified in the packet.Return value
Entity ID.int getRequestType()
Returns the value of the Request Type parameter specified in the packet.Return value
Request Type parameter value. The following values are supported:- 0 - HAT
- 1 - HOT
- 2 - Extended
int getCoordSystem()
Returns the value of the Coordinate System parameter specified in the packet.Return value
Coordinate System parameter value. The following values are supported:- 0 - Geodetic
- 1 - Entity
unsigned int getUpdatePeriod()
Returns the value of the Update Period parameter specified in the packet. Determines the interval between successive responses to this request.Return value
Update Period parameter value. The following values are supported:- 0 - One-Shot request
- > 0 - update period
const Math::Vec3 & getPosition()
Returns the coordinates of the point, from which the HAT/HOT request is being made.Return value
Coordinates of the point, from which the HAT/HOT request is being made.Last update: 2017-12-21
Help improve this article
Was this article helpful?
(or select a word/phrase and press Ctrl+Enter)